SystemTap consists of software that provides a command line interface and scripting language for analyzing a running Linux kernel, similar in concept to DTrace found in Solaris operating system and other systems. Data may be extracted, filtered, and summarized quickly and safely to enable diagnosis of complex performance or functional problems. SystemTap is an open source project with contributors from Red Hat, IBM, Intel, Hitachi, Oracle and other community members.
